Australia -- Western Australia Weather Update

MELBOURNE - Nov 11/10 - SNS -- The current forecast for the state of Western Australia was released by Australia's Bureau of Meteorology.

Warning summary
Fire Weather Warning for the Shire of Roebourne and Town of Port Hedland
sub-districts of the Pilbara.
Strong Wind Warning for coastal waters from Wallal to Mandurah.
Forecast for Thursday
Kimberley, northeastern and southern Interior and the adjacent Goldfields and
Eucla: Isolated afternoon and evening thunderstorms and showers.
Southern parts of the SW Land Division, far southern Goldfields, and the far
west of the Eucla: Isolated showers, tending scattered near the south coast east
of Albany. Showers contracting to the south coast in the evening.
Lower West: Isolated showers, clearing in the early afternoon.
Forecast for Friday
Central and eastern Interior, extending into the southern and eastern Kimberley
in the afternoon: Isolated thunderstorms and showers.
Southern coastal parts of the SW Land Division and the far western Eucla:
Isolated showers.
